Vegetable supplier grows business with Aldi

A sixth-generation family-owned vegetable grower based in Staffordshire is celebrating after bolstering its supply deal with Aldi.

R & RW Bartlett, located in Shenstone, has been supplying carrots and parsnips to the supermarket since 2011 – recently extending that partnership to move from supplying two to three of the supermarket’s depots.

The family has been farming in Staffordshire since the 1800s, though it was in the 1950s when owner Roy and his mother started selling their home-grown vegetables to local markets. In 1984, Roy and his son Rod formed R & RW Bartlett as the business is known today, with Rod’s daughter joining the team in 2011.

The partnership has allowed R & RW Bartlett to extend its operations significantly over the years, providing them with the stability and assurance to plan ahead and invest in staff, equipment and improved facilities.

With Christmas being a particularly busy time for the vegetable grower, the latest festive season was no different.

Between four and five lorry loads of carrots and parsnips were delivered to Aldi on some of the busiest days – with families across the country tucking into R & RW Bartlett’s produce on Christmas day.
